AN ACT CONCERNING LIABILITY OF HOME HEALTH CARE AGENCIES FOR PERSONS THEY SEND TO CLIENTS.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ives in General Assembly convened:
That section 19a-491 of the general statutes be amended to clarify that home health care and homemaker-home health aide agencies are liable for the acts of persons they assign or refer to clients.
Statement of Purpose:
To clarify that home health care agencies are liable for the acts of their agents.
